Title |
Adaptive Optics Ophthalmoscopy, Autofluorescence Photography and Microperimetry |

Description |
Recently, technologies that have captured the attention of the subspecialties of retina and glaucoma, such as optical coherence tomography, multifocal electroretinography and multifocal visual evoked potentials, have been adapted for use in Neuro-Ophthalmology. The purpose of the this talk is to point out some other technologies which have attracted interest mostly outside of Neuro-Ophthalmology that have been used by a few early adaptors, and call attention to possible neuro-ophthalmologic uses. |
